This might seem controversial, but I really think people can read paragraphs. I don’t think a few sentences grouped together in a rectangular format will make someone’s head explode. Apparently a lot of other people do though. Hence many sites are filled with what has been labeled “Broetry.” That is when every sentence gets its own paragraph for fear that something lengthier would scare readers off. If you are writing instructions for dismantling an explosive device, by all means, keep things as simple as possible. If you are trying to sell people that you are a mature businessperson and intellectually gifted, maybe a good start would be demonstrating that you can write a paragraph more complicated than “See Spot run.”
